Here’s a step-by-step guide on how to search and use Instagram filters effectively:
1. Open the Instagram App
Launch the Instagram app on your mobile device and log in to your account. Filters can be used on both photos and videos, but the full library is accessible only through the Instagram camera within Stories or Reels.
2. Go to the Camera
From your home feed, swipe right or tap the “+” icon at the top of the screen. Select either Story or Reel to open the Instagram camera. At the bottom of your screen, you’ll notice a row of filters — a mix of your saved effects and some of the most popular ones.
3. Access the Filter Search Option
Swipe to the far right of the filter row until you reach the Browse Effects or Effect Gallery option, indicated by a magnifying glass icon. This is where you can explore a wide variety of filters from creators all over the world.
4. Search for a Specific Filter
In the Effect Gallery, tap the search icon at the top. Enter a keyword that describes the type of effect you’re looking for, such as:
- “Vintage” for retro aesthetics
- “Sparkle” for glitter effects
- “Cartoon” for animated styles
Instagram will display matching filters, complete with previews to help you choose.
5. Preview the Filter
Select a filter to open its preview page. You can watch a short demo video, test it instantly with your camera, or decide whether it’s worth saving.
6. Save and Use the Filter
If you like what you see, tap the Save button. The filter will now appear in your camera’s filter lineup, making it easy to access whenever you create Stories or Reels.
7. Explore Categories for Inspiration
Not sure what to search for? Browse through categories like Trending, Selfies, Color and Light, Funny, or Backgrounds. This is a great way to discover new filters you might not have considered.
